The bumpy road to prosperity: Why human contact beats the internet every time August 6, 2015 2:39 amIssues Work LifeVaughn Davis READ MORE
The battle for catchy domain names just got a whole lot shorter but is it really all that sweeter? November 11, 2014 4:27 amTechJohan Chang READ MORE